Internal combustion engine (ICE) vehicles represent the single largest source of carbon dioxide emissions for most US households. Although battery electric vehicles (BEVs) considerably reduce use-phase emissions,周论 the transition poses a fundamental life cycle optimization challenge: Is there a net climate benefit to retiring a functional ICE vehicle before its end of life? Retiring a functioning ICE vehicle incurs a fundamental trade-off between BEV manufacturing emissions and decreased vehicle operation emissions. In this study, we evaluated this trade-off across a comprehensive range of retirement scenarios and found that scrappage-and-replacement yields consistent emissions reductions across most contexts, including the retirement of new ICE vehicles. Although scrapping a functional asset remains economically prohibitive under current market conditions, these results demonstrate a major mitigation potential for policy interventions, such as enhanced scrappage subsidies, to address the emissions of an increasingly durable ICE fleet.

Mucus is 科学known as a viscous fluid; yet, snails manufacture various mucus-based materials with much higher cohesion and tailored to different and even antagonistic functions, including lubrication, adhesion, protection, and defense. To gain insight into this versatility, we use a multidisciplinary approach to investigate five different mucus-based materials produced by the snail Cepaea nemoralis. Our results demonstrate that snails use collagen VI as a main structural component and add amorphous calcium carbonate (ACC) during mucus secretion. ACC functions as an ion source in wet mucus types, most likely for cross-linking, or as a mineral precursor in dry mucus types. These findings shed light on the versatility of these viscoelastic materials, which are able to switch between very different properties on the basis of calcium and protein content.
